FAQ: Why does InkSpool sometimes render blank invoices?

Short answer: font cache corruption. The PDF renderer at Quenby Labs embeds a subset of the Marlin Sans face, and if the cache directory is wiped mid-run, you get pristine-looking but empty invoices. Fix: stop the worker, clear `/var/inkspool/fontcache`, restart. If the renderer refuses to start afterwards, its config bundle is sealed and needs unsealing. The unseal step will prompt you for the recovery passphrase, which is printed below.

vault phrase of yagug-yahap = aldvan-istdor-nordor-sileth-pelok-julwyn-pelwyn-ralvan-tamix-eliius-belox-casir-tamys-giliel

Tile prefetcher for Wanderly Maps keeps dropping its DB connection mid-batch — looks like we hold the pool open across the whole region sweep and the idle timeout bites us. Fix is to checkpoint per tile group. To reproduce against staging, run the prefetcher pointed at this connection string.

primary connection of yagep-kahip = redis://giliel_svc:zYiKsLL2PLpfPL@db-348f.xolmarsys.corp:5432/fenwyn

**Q: Do I need to generate a new idempotency key when retrying a failed charge through the Tollgate API?**

No. Reuse the same key for retries of the same logical payment; Tollgate deduplicates on it for 48 hours. Generate a fresh key only when the customer intends a new charge. Key format rules, expiry behavior, and edge cases are covered in the reference page below.

wiki page, tahaf-tajog: https://jira.ordindyn.corp/pipeline